The Next Decade Belongs to People Who Redesign Their Jobs Now.

Most conversations about AI and work get stuck on the wrong question: “Will AI replace my job?” That question is too blunt to be useful. It treats a job as a single, indivisible thing, when in reality, every job is a bundle of smaller pieces. If you want to stay useful in the age of AI, you need a more accurate lens. When AI Makes Your Job Easier, You'll Get More Work (Not Less)

Experts predicted that super-accurate AI radiology would kill radiology jobs. Instead it increased demand. This is Jevon’s paradox, and it’s going to happen in your industry too.
